At MMW, we know many of you have spouses or family in the military; we are also aware that supporting our Troops means more than wearing a lapel pin- but often, we really just don’t know what to do. Here, Mo Mommy, wife of a deployed serviceman, mother of three, MMW reader and member of the LDS church, offers her point of view on some real things individuals can do to help families who are facing the prolonged separation and stress deployment brings. It has come to my attention that some people’s comments have gone into moderation and are requiring approval before appearing on the site. I still don’t know why. They weren’t trying to sell us drugs or porn or anything!
It’s only a few comments here and there, and it’s not a huge problem, but if your comment doesn’t appear right away, please don’t panic. It could be technical difficulties, or that your comment has the word ‘viagra’ in it.
I haven’t banned any of you. But don’t think I won’t. Because I so can.
And also, if you have 3 links or more in your comment, it automatically goes into moderation, so if you have a lot of links to share, you can either do it in one comment and wait for it to be approved, or spread them out over multiple comments, thereby making us look more popular.
